PHPerKaigi 2021 とは
- 公式サイト https://phperkaigi.jp/2021
- 公式Twitter https://twitter.com/phperkaigi
- ハッシュタグ #phperkaigi
PHPerによるPHPerのためのお祭り!
日時
3/26(金) 16:00 - 前夜祭
3/27(土) 10:00 - 本編1日目
3/28(日) 10:00 - 本編2日目
PHPerKaigi 2021 YouTube再生リスト
PHPerKaigi 2021 ブログリンク一覧
PHPerKaigi 2021 スピーカー一覧
タイムテーブル
ニコ生の番組URLは以下です。
■3月26日(金) day0 前夜祭
Track A: http://live.nicovideo.jp/watch/lv330956367
Track B: http://live.nicovideo.jp/watch/lv330956373
■3月27日(土) day1
Track A: http://live.nicovideo.jp/watch/lv330956380
Track B: http://live.nicovideo.jp/watch/lv330956382
■3月28日(日) day2
Track A: http://live.nicovideo.jp/watch/lv330956396
Track B: http://live.nicovideo.jp/watch/lv330956402
- プレミアム会員だと「追っかけ再生」ができます。
- トーク動画は後日、YouTubeで公開されるとのことです。
- すぐ動画みたい方はニコニコ動画に課金してください!
PHPerKaigi 2021 スライドまとめ
3/26(金)
3/26(金)Track A
LAMPをこじらせてサーバーレスに乗り遅れたPHPerがLambdaに入門してみる/ちゃちい
- https://speakerdeck.com/chatii/lampwokozirasetesabaresunicheng-richi-retaphpergalambdaniru-men-sitemiru
- https://fortee.jp/phperkaigi-2021/proposal/3ecf05a6-599a-41e6-9645-2eb016d8f429
- https://twitter.com/chatii0079
大規模サイトにおけるSEO観点でのURL設計/前川昌幸
- https://speakerdeck.com/maepon/da-gui-mo-saitoniokeruseoguan-dian-defalseurlshe-ji
- https://fortee.jp/phperkaigi-2021/proposal/fbff7977-8a35-4211-a77e-0c924f41e692
- https://twitter.com/maepon
PHPerでもわかる!実践Webアクセシビリティ/有木 詩織
- https://www.slideshare.net/shiorikoga/webaccessibilitypracticeforphper
- https://fortee.jp/phperkaigi-2021/proposal/2ad09067-1c9f-41ce-8574-7abb06f65ce4
- https://twitter.com/shiori_pk
PHP でファイルシステムを作ろう/sji
- https://www.slideshare.net/shinjiigarashi/php-246134442
- https://fortee.jp/phperkaigi-2021/proposal/510429b6-766e-4740-a0dc-3d5084fb3c1c
- https://twitter.com/sji_ch
3/26(金)Track B
PHP製のPodCast配信用WebアプリをReact+Next.jsなSSGで作り直してみた話/渡辺一宏
- https://speakerdeck.com/kaz29/phpzhi-falsepodcastpei-xin-yong-webapuriworeact-plus-next-dot-jsnassgdezuo-rizhi-sitemitahua
- https://fortee.jp/phperkaigi-2021/proposal/c6413471-6ec3-4e1e-844c-47f982fd44d0
- https://twitter.com/kaz_29
- https://github.com/kaz29/hbsakaba
ユースケースシナリオのススメ/丹賀 健一
- https://speakerdeck.com/dnskimo/yusukesusinariofalsesusume
- https://fortee.jp/phperkaigi-2021/proposal/83fcf1fe-e884-4fe4-b3ef-4546ad6f4c34
- https://twitter.com/dnskimox
スポンサー担当するのは楽しい/きくもと
- https://fortee.jp/phperkaigi-2021/proposal/bb74394c-eca8-4f63-b3bb-022fc7453357
- https://twitter.com/takakiku
Terraformのレポジトリ、ディレクトリ構成どうする?/よこやまたつお
- https://speakerdeck.com/tatsuo48/terraform-repository-directory-structure-what-should-i-do
- https://fortee.jp/phperkaigi-2021/proposal/cea7648a-76d8-4526-9dbf-b09a99395a3a
- https://twitter.com/tatsuo4848
3/27(土)
3/27(土)Track A
実践ATDD 〜TDDから更に歩みを進めたソフトウェア開発へ〜/東口 和暉
- https://speakerdeck.com/hgsgtk/atdd-by-genba-example
- https://fortee.jp/phperkaigi-2021/proposal/74efffd2-0ac3-4591-beaf-541f48879d6e
- https://twitter.com/hgsgtk
静的型解析を用いた大規模レガシーコードのリファクタリング計画/たけうちよしたか
- https://fortee.jp/phperkaigi-2021/proposal/35177e2b-189c-43c2-ad29-e74caf5033e7
- https://twitter.com/yosatak
負荷試験の観点から見るGraphQLにおけるPHPのコードチューニング/遠藤大輔
- https://speakerdeck.com/d_endo/fu-he-shi-yan-falseguan-dian-karajian-rugraphqlniokeruphpfalsekodotiyuningu-ba5d2e8d-6b6b-4969-a627-e4ac988ae251
- https://fortee.jp/phperkaigi-2021/proposal/e544480b-4c90-4a42-8267-995f00544ae6
- https://twitter.com/DddEndow
目的に沿ったDocumentation as Codeをいかにして実現していくか/小山健一郎
- https://speakerdeck.com/k1low/phperkaigi-2021
- https://fortee.jp/phperkaigi-2021/proposal/42ce8b07-6972-42bb-a2ac-96af7249cfa4
- https://twitter.com/k1LoW
PHPで学ぶ、セッションの基本と応用/富所亮
- https://speakerdeck.com/hanhan1978/web-app-session-101
- https://fortee.jp/phperkaigi-2021/proposal/9f8863cc-39b8-4bf7-aed7-f5be070c3bfb
- https://twitter.com/hanhan1978
PHP8になった今の時代に、PHPの「エラー」「例外」そして「Error」をおさらいしておこう/きんじょうひでき
- https://speakerdeck.com/o0h/phperkaigi2021-regular-talk
- https://daisuki.nichiyoubi.land/entry/2021/03/27/033403
- https://fortee.jp/phperkaigi-2021/proposal/e1e0ebd8-d60c-42ed-b6e6-9a7602258d42
- https://twitter.com/o0h_
Laravel のメール認証の内部実装を掘り下げる/Kosuke Hamada
- https://speakerdeck.com/hamakou108/laravel-falsemeruren-zheng-falsenei-bu-shi-zhuang-wojue-rixia-geru-phperkaigi-2021
- https://github.com/hamakou108/laravel-separate-user-sample
- https://fortee.jp/phperkaigi-2021/proposal/1db5378c-8794-48b5-ba22-b2736861ef66
- https://twitter.com/hamakou108
ブラウザから始めるgRPC 〜 gRPC-WebにPHPを添えて/中榮健二
- https://speakerdeck.com/n1215/burauzakarashi-merugrpc-grpc-webniphpwotian-ete
- https://fortee.jp/phperkaigi-2021/proposal/25ad8bff-c707-44eb-a47d-aaa2b65a79b4
- https://twitter.com/n_1215
PHP でもアーキテクチャテストしたい!/かわなみゆう
- https://speakerdeck.com/kawanamiyuu/phperkaigi-2021
- https://fortee.jp/phperkaigi-2021/proposal/4658ce92-3c45-43f3-a14c-76787e923725
- https://twitter.com/kawanamiyuu
3/27(土)Track B
Laravel Livewire でアプリケーションを作成した話/localdisk
- https://fortee.jp/phperkaigi-2021/proposal/36aaef2a-7621-4257-ba07-1e05b6825d8a
- https://twitter.com/localdisk
PHP7から定数配列がOPcacheに乗るのでKVSを置き換えられるかもしれない話/hnw
- https://www.slideshare.net/hnw/php7opcachekvs
- https://fortee.jp/phperkaigi-2021/proposal/3a85b3f7-71f1-4421-bf1f-3f9c7cd9e1d7
- https://twitter.com/hnw
テクニカルサポートに精一杯だったチームが、安定運用のための開発を行えるようになるまでの道のり/杉山祐一
- https://fortee.jp/phperkaigi-2021/proposal/ea3d8d4b-c387-4322-8292-a5ef7b8d2914
- https://twitter.com/oogFranz
PHPでCSVを安心して扱うために/若葉 章
- https://speakerdeck.com/ickx/phperkaigi2021-phpdecsvwoan-xin-sitexi-utameni
- https://fortee.jp/phperkaigi-2021/proposal/893d264c-16a3-491b-99a2-d1c4a533d923
- https://twitter.com/effy_staffs
swoole と laravel-swoole を用いたハイパフォーマンスアプリケーションの構築/めもり〜
- https://speakerdeck.com/memory1994/swoole-to-laravel-swoole-woyong-itahaipahuomansuapurikesiyongou-zhu
- https://fortee.jp/phperkaigi-2021/proposal/126429c8-7ac0-4b56-8494-802e07466386
- https://twitter.com/m3m0r7
PHP8版!Swooleのフレームワークを比べてみた/株式会社サイバーエージェント 白井 英
- https://speakerdeck.com/sgeengineer/php8ban-swoolefalsehuremuwakuwobi-betemita-5d50215c-77f4-4a06-b908-d5df5475b621
- https://fortee.jp/phperkaigi-2021/proposal/83f27671-7fbf-4cdb-a238-c992aeb4f207
- https://twitter.com/goodoo
PHPerの知らないビットボードの世界/Qwert
- https://fortee.jp/phperkaigi-2021/proposal/c4e7ed1a-f773-4e67-b775-12b085f8ca09
- https://twitter.com/ilovenamichang
PHPWebアプリケーションパフォーマンスチューニング/清家史郎
- https://speakerdeck.com/seike460/php-web-application-performance-tuning
- https://fortee.jp/phperkaigi-2021/proposal/1d6859e3-26e4-4918-8603-44ecc3c61666
- https://twitter.com/seike460
モックの泥沼から脱却するために、あえてDBにつないでテストしている話/かずへい
- https://speakerdeck.com/kazuhei0108/motukufalseni-zhao-karatuo-que-surutameni-aetedbnitunaidetesutositeiruhua
- https://fortee.jp/phperkaigi-2021/proposal/d3f8ee1e-faba-490c-bcef-d374681b9e4d
- https://twitter.com/kazuhei__
3/28(日)
3/28(日)Track A
ぼくがかんがえたさいきょうのMySQLの監視スクリプトを読み解く/yoku0825
- https://speakerdeck.com/yoku0825/bokugakangaetasaikiyoufalsemysqlfalsejian-shi-sukuriputowodu-mijie-ku
- https://fortee.jp/phperkaigi-2021/proposal/8de8d5b1-2394-4d05-b5cd-069b0940a933
- https://twitter.com/yoku0825
PHPでImageMagickとICUを使って画像に縦書きテキストを描画する/rokuroku
- https://speakerdeck.com/cc4966/draw-vertical-text-in-php-using-imagemagick-and-icu
- https://fortee.jp/phperkaigi-2021/proposal/8fcc5080-209c-406c-99fb-a4d03b845898
- https://twitter.com/496_
なるせ先生のPHP学~PHP8新機能スペシャル~/成瀬 允宣
- https://github.com/nrslib/PHPerKaigi-2021
- https://fortee.jp/phperkaigi-2021/proposal/a32d3d23-95b3-482f-a0d2-05c461c9d063
- https://twitter.com/nrslib
作って理解するDIコンテナ/うさみけんた
- https://tadsan.fanbox.cc/posts/2061773
- https://fortee.jp/phperkaigi-2021/proposal/5fc8ee67-1171-47e2-bfaf-ef428e93d07e
- https://twitter.com/tadsan
今こそ理解するDI(Dependency Injection)/Sho Yamada
- https://speakerdeck.com/rukiadia/understand-dependency-injection-of-php
- https://fortee.jp/phperkaigi-2021/proposal/bfa7dda5-fa76-472f-bfbb-3e76f3434581
- https://twitter.com/rukiadia
PHPのDI、attributesとこれから/山岡広幸
- https://speakerdeck.com/hiro_y/php-di-with-attributes
- https://fortee.jp/phperkaigi-2021/proposal/778d3c86-5d94-4419-aa98-f7d2c7a1962e
- https://twitter.com/hiro_y
3/28(日)Track B
そのコード、フレームワークの外でも動きますか?/菱田裕美
- https://tech.quartetcom.co.jp/2021/03/28/phperkaigi-2021/
- https://fortee.jp/phperkaigi-2021/proposal/43f0d237-e254-4836-8275-9027d27a80ef
- https://twitter.com/77web
無駄な物をなるべく作らないリプレイス戦略/高野福晃
- https://speakerdeck.com/fortkle/replace-strategy-phperkaigi2021
- https://fortee.jp/phperkaigi-2021/proposal/91a31b25-3b53-46f1-8510-3c7f24158588
- https://twitter.com/fortkle
CMSとフレームワークの良いとこ取り!PHPerのためのDrupal入門/丸山 ひかる
- https://fortee.jp/phperkaigi-2021/proposal/3e507cbe-9d3f-4e01-937a-b208b98babb3
- https://twitter.com/maruyamahiakru
トラブルのない決済システムを作ろうと奮闘したお話/千葉
プログラマ三大美徳を実現するデプロイフローを目指して/yamotuki
- https://fortee.jp/phperkaigi-2021/proposal/68ae9482-8280-4ef1-b207-cee6614aef51
- https://twitter.com/yamotuki
- https://www.slideshare.net/mobile/TomoyaSuzuki9/ss-245212055
DNSを制するものはインターネットを制す! DNSの世界/市川@cakephper
- https://docs.google.com/presentation/d/1K0hLqIXQ_lvoPPQVe4Ey_lNbhmFRozuQicuRSh3st_I/edit#slide=id.p
- https://fortee.jp/phperkaigi-2021/proposal/71d673b5-b64f-4e32-8e71-4800b022b237
- https://twitter.com/cakephper
マンガではわからないソフトウェア開発の真理/田中ひさてる
- https://www.docswell.com/s/tanakahisateru/MK3LE5-2021-03-28-123202
- https://fortee.jp/phperkaigi-2021/proposal/5112da42-920b-49c3-bedd-c5e19d7167bf
- https://twitter.com/tanakahisateru
LT
PHPUnit 9 時代のTest Doubleの作り方/東口 和暉
- https://speakerdeck.com/hgsgtk/deep-dive-into-mockbuilder-of-phpunit-9
- https://fortee.jp/phperkaigi-2021/proposal/f8796b27-b4f3-4695-b5fc-709e416ae337
- https://twitter.com/hgsgtk
ある日突然、Laravel Queue Workerが壊れた/Kenjiro Kubota
- https://fortee.jp/phperkaigi-2021/proposal/e47c493e-4ebb-4fbe-9017-5b1179b1b05b
- https://twitter.com/kubotak_public
Web API開発をするなら、ドキュメントは自動生成にしておこう!/Akito
- https://speakerdeck.com/akitotsukahara/web-apikai-fa-wosurunara-dokiyumentohazi-dong-sheng-cheng-nisiteokou-phperkaigi2021
- https://fortee.jp/phperkaigi-2021/proposal/976b1869-082b-4309-a2c5-f23ae43bd134
- https://twitter.com/AkitoTsukahara
新社会人のコード品質カイゼン記録/頓花貴俊
- https://fortee.jp/phperkaigi-2021/proposal/294f82a6-4217-4446-ad0a-61a9dc6d6d95
- https://twitter.com/zaregoto32
PHPで簡単コード生成!同じようなコードをたくさん書くならコード生成しチャイナ!/つざき
- https://docs.google.com/presentation/d/1U8gnE3kPgeXTYI-RGmoewjUXONpQimy9fi6Nf5YenTY/edit
- https://fortee.jp/phperkaigi-2021/proposal/d23fb69f-59be-406f-abb6-fc4fa2d3f61e
- https://twitter.com/820zacky
Laravelプロダクト Fargate化への道/sogaoh
- https://speakerdeck.com/sogaoh/road-to-fargate-of-laravel-products
- https://fortee.jp/phperkaigi-2021/proposal/7aa8bb61-b649-4a29-a96e-f8edef026f98
- https://twitter.com/sogaoh
それ make で出来るよ/タケタニヒロト
- https://speakerdeck.com/take_3/phperkaigi2021-lt-make
- https://fortee.jp/phperkaigi-2021/proposal/95e16a49-35f9-47ac-85bb-cc390d324c56
- https://twitter.com/take_3
データベースを利用したテストを軽〜く実行したい時の味方: vimeo/php-mysql-engine/きんじょうひでき
- https://speakerdeck.com/o0h/phperkaigi2021-lightning-talk
- https://fortee.jp/phperkaigi-2021/proposal/85a9d12d-8a4a-44b9-b8ae-c28015b9d6a5
- https://twitter.com/o0h_